Output ef536af854ce5e9e958a8824251ec69293508f0e16aa7aa78cea05de27b579a6:0

value
53600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5e756561540cf69788f89370f988acc76fd412c OP_EQUAL
address
3Q7Ec8rRGZbMRYxu4NuZU22avnjuGmQrNG
transaction
ef536af854ce5e9e958a8824251ec69293508f0e16aa7aa78cea05de27b579a6
spent
true